TestExplora: Benchmarking LLMs for Proactive Bug Discovery via Repository-Level Test Generation

Steven Liu, Jane Luo, Xin Zhang, Aofan Liu, Hao Liu, Jie Wu, Ziyang Huang, Yangyu Huang

Abstract

Given that Large Language Models (LLMs) are increasingly applied to automate software development, comprehensive software assurance spans three distinct goals: regression prevention, reactive reproduction, and proactive discovery. Current evaluations systematically overlook the third goal. Specifically, they either constrain models to a compliance trap by treating existing code as the ground truth for regression prevention, or rely on post-failure artifacts (e.g., issue reports) for reactive bug reproduction, failing to expose defects before they manifest as failures. To bridge this gap, we present TestExplora, a benchmark designed to evaluate LLMs as proactive testers within full-scale, realistic repository environments. Comprising 2,389 tasks across 482 repositories, TestExplora conceals all defect-related information, forcing models to uncover bugs by identifying discrepancies between implementation and documentation-derived intent—utilizing documentation as the reference oracle. Furthermore, to ensure sustainable evaluation and mitigate risks of data leakage in static datasets, we propose a continuous, time-aware data collection framework. Our evaluation reveals a significant capability gap: state-of-the-art models achieve a maximum Fail-to-Pass ($F2P$) rate of only 16.06%. Further analysis indicates that navigating complex cross-module interactions and leveraging agentic exploration are critical to advancing LLMs toward autonomous software quality assurance. Consistent with this, SWEAgent instantiated with GPT-5-mini achieves an $F2P$ of 17.27% and an $F2P@5$ of 29.7%, highlighting the effectiveness and promise of agentic exploration in proactive bug discovery tasks.
